Brushing the dust off this old thread ... whew.
Now and then, a CCC user will mention that they've got issues where the bad guy drop targets don't reset properly. Most recently pinsider mal7887 brought it up in relation to the MM tribute mode.
In the past, whenever someone brought this up, I'd check the way the code worked on my machine and things seemed fine - but I didn't really investigate very far. Today, I spent a bit more time trying to figure out what's going on. It turns out that it's likely a friction problem between the drop target and the lifting mech in most cases.
When testing it, if I carefully pushed back the drop target just enough to get it to fall, even though the coil disabled, the lifting mech wouldn't drop. The pressure from the drop target holds up the un-powered lifting portion. If I'd push back the target to give it a bit of space, the mech would fall and the target would reset normally. The CC targets don't have a 'reset' coil, they're just controlled in an upward motion. The 'reset' is controlled by springs and gravity.
Mine reset fine most of the time -- but I can definitely replicate the poor resetting some people have reported, and I can't find any way to help this situation with code, since there's nothing about the reset I can really control.
I'm not really sure what the best way to mitigate this is. Weaker spring forcing the drop target forward? Stronger spring pushing the drop mech down?

Working on code for Scott's next game has all the coding juices flowing, so I've been working on CC a bit on the weekends. Should have a new update out soon-ish with some slight changes/fixes/updates.

If anybody has any "hey I noticed a broken thing" or "hey you really should change/fix" now would be the time to pipe up with that.

Recent tweaks of note:
- Added some color to the multiball restart screen
- Boosted the volume of the 'yackety sax' music during Franks & Beans
- Added skill shot awards that add flips to the 'flip count' party mode
- Added a user setting for killing the pop bumper activity after x hits to the bottom bumper (this was always in the code, now its tweak able)
- Killed showing the "replay score is" on ball 3 if you're starting an extra ball
- If you earn an extra ball on your own when the 'bozo ball' is lit on the outlanes, it will disable the bozo ball.
- Crash bug fixed in stampede (typo in one routine - wouldn't always come up)
- Fixed the game losing track of things if the ball drained during "showdown" start up.
- Default setting for showdown changed to a single add-a-ball (set "Showdown Difficulty" back to "Easy" to allow endless add-a-ball)
- Changed the wording on the polly mode 'fail' screens if you drain before time runs out "TOO LATE!" didn't make sense
- Added a settings backup that will hopefully prevent people who cold-cut the power to the game from losing their settings often
- Fixed a timing issue on the player number call out when ball is sitting in the skilshot lane
- Fixed an issue with cross contamination between players on bart brothers progress
- Added a thing to show current scores during the skill shot for 2 seconds if you tap both flippers together

The backup settings thing was just something to be nice to the people who set up their own without the power control board -- I really thought about not adding it at all, since for the computer's sake it should have the safe shutdown; but reality is that there are people who turn their games on/off at the wall with a switch or home automation and it sucks for people who have to play those machines when everything gets blanked so I figured I'd throw in SOME effort to try to prevent it.
